About Henry
Meet Henry, an adorable ball of energy who lights up any room he enters with his joyful exuberance and affectionate nature. This playful pup is always eager for an adventure, whether it be a walk in the park or a frolic in your backyard. Not only is Henry a sweet-natured companion, but he also comes leash and toilet trained, making him a breeze to bring into your daily routine.
Henry is incredibly responsive to commands and enjoys engaging with his humans, which means he's keen and excited to learn new tricks and skills. His friendly demeanour has him getting along well with people and other dogs, demonstrating a remarkable balance of being both submissive and dominant during play, depending on his playmate's style. This adaptable social character makes him a versatile companion in various settings.
Barking is not in Henry's nature unless it's truly necessary, and he approaches life with a calm confidence that means anxious tendencies are not part of his personality. He is an excellent playmate for large dogs, though he hasn't been tested with smaller dogs or cats yet, suggesting that careful introductions would help him adapt successfully.

Adoption details
Please do not apply to adopt via our animals' PetRescue profile.
Follow the links below to be directed to the Wollongong City Council website, and find your preferred animal's online profile.
Once in the online profile, scroll down and click the link to complete an adoption application. Once received, a member of our team will be in touch to discuss your application and suitability for your preferred animal.
If we deem the animal to be suitable for your home and lifestyle, an in-person meet and greet may be organised. Should your meet and greet be a success, you can take your new furry friend home that day or following their desexing surgery. Our team will manage all your animal's paperwork, including ownership and vaccination documentation.
